In a deeply emotional announcement, Gutfeld! co-host Kat Timpf shared that she will be stepping away from the Fox News late-night show for a short period to focus on her ongoing battle with breast cancer. At 36, Timpf revealed that she is preparing for another surgery as part of her recovery following a double mastectomy.
During the episode, Timpf spoke candidly about the challenges ahead, offering viewers a glimpse into the physical and emotional journey she continues to navigate. Later, on Instagram, she reassured her fans that her absence would only last a few weeks. “The best-case scenario with breast cancer still involves a long road to feeling whole again, and this is just the first step,” she explained, giving a heartfelt look at her determination.
Timpf, known for her sharp wit and humor, also addressed any speculation about her whereabouts. “So the internet doesn’t start guessing, that’s exactly where I am,” she joked, blending honesty with her signature comedic touch.

Her public openness about her health journey began earlier this year when she shared her stage zero breast cancer diagnosis—just one day before giving birth to her first child. Balancing motherhood with treatment, including a double mastectomy, has been an incredibly challenging experience, yet Timpf faced it with courage and transparency, earning immense support from fans and colleagues alike.

Celebrities and peers have also expressed admiration. Rachel Campos-Duffy praised her as “the very definition of a strong mom,” Meghan McCain sent love and support, and Janice Dean added a heartfelt, “Love youuuuuuuuuuu!”
Even in the face of online trolls, Timpf has remained steadfast. When criticized for sharing updates about her cancer journey, she responded with grace and humor: “I will likely talk about this for the rest of my life—it affects me that long. Making jokes heals me, and I won’t stop. If it offends you, feel free to unfollow.” Her response highlighted the resilience and authenticity that have endeared her to so many.

Timpf’s journey has been a mix of vulnerability, strength, and humor. Following her double mastectomy, she shared a lighthearted post from her hospital bed: “Post-op! They’re honestly not much smaller than they were before I got pregnant.” Her blend of honesty and comedy has helped normalize difficult conversations about cancer, especially for younger women navigating similar struggles.
As she takes a few weeks away from Gutfeld!, fans continue to flood her with messages of encouragement. Timpf expressed her gratitude on Instagram: “I’ll be back on Gutfeld! in a few weeks! Huge thanks to those who have sent me kindness and support. I love you all so much 😢❤️.”
